1. Teefs, Lylla, and Floor’s death in Guardians of the Galaxy Vol. 3

Guardians of the Galaxy Vol. 3 took us on an emotional roller coaster, particularly with the heart-wrenching deaths of Lylla, Floor, and Teefs. These characters, though not central in the grand scheme of things, had etched their way into our hearts with their unique flaws, charm, and presence. Their exits from the story were not just moments in the plot - they were emotional landmarks that left a lingering and huge sense of loss and pain. It's the kind of cinematic moment where you find yourself wishing for a Men in Black-style memory eraser, just to dull the sharp pang of their unnecessary and cruelly played out departure.

The way these characters fit into the narrative made their loss feel all the more painful. It wasn't just the shock value or the gravity of the scenes, but the way their life stories were told to us in little tiny bits - so we could piece the sad and cruelty-filled moments ourselves. Marvel has always had a knack for making even the smallest characters matter, and in Guardians 3, they proved this yet again. The emotional impact was close to losing a dear pet, leaving a bittersweet feeling that lingered long after the credits rolled. As a matter of fact, anytime I rewatch Guardians 3, tears still flood my eyes and fall down my cheeks in this scene. Every. Time. 

It's a testament to the excellent storytelling in the MCU that even as we wish we could forget these painful goodbyes, we also can't help but be grateful for the very brief and sad moments we shared with Lylla, Floor, and Teefs.

Verdict: A moment we wish we could forget!
